/* ESTILO FINAL */

* { padding: 0; border: 0; margin: 0;}

body {
font-family:Helvetica, Arial, sans-serif;
font-size: 12px;
color:#999999;
background:url(img/bg.jpg);
background-repeat:repeat;
background-attachment:fixed;
}
a:link { 
text-decoration:none;
color:#999999;
}
a:visited {
text-decoration: none;
color:#999999;
}
a:hover {
text-decoration:none;
background:transparent;
color:#333333;
}
.menu {
margin:0px auto 0px auto;
}
.banner {
height:77px;
width:auto;
background-image:url(img/banner.png);
padding-top:14px;
}

/* ETIQUETA RSS */
.social {
float:right;
margin-top:-58px;
margin-left: -20px;
width:98px;
}
.facebook{
border:0px;
}
.flickr{
border:0px;
margin-top:2px;
}
.suscribete img{
float:left;
margin:5px 0px 0px 5px;
}
.form {
background-image:url(img/rss/rss.png);
margin-left:399px;
width:362px;
height:61px;
}
input {  /* LETRA DEL CUADRO MAIL */
font-family:Arial, Helvetica, sans-serif;
font-size: 10px; 
color: #cccccc; 
background-color: #474747; 
padding:1px 2px;
}
.boton {
color:#FFFFFF;
font-size:1px;
width:46px;
height:16px;
background-image:url(img/rss/enviar.png);
}
.boton_pos {
margin-left:204px;
margin-top:-15px;
}
.cuadromail {
margin:39px 0px 0px 9px;
width:134px;
}
/* ETIQUETA RSS */



* html .contenedor_general{  /*para IE*/
background-image:none;
background-color:#FFFFFF;
width: 761px;
padding: 0px 0px 0px 0px;
margin: 0px auto 0px auto;
border:0;
overflow:hidden;
}
.contenedor_general { 
background:url(img/fondo_contenedor.png);
width: 761px;
padding: 0px 10px 0px 10px;
margin: 0px auto 0px auto;
}
.botonera {
background:url(img/fondomenu.jpg);
width: 761px;
height: 31px;
}


/* SECCION MARCAS HOMBRE Y MUJER */
.contenido_marcas {
width: 729px;
padding: 20px 12px 30px 20px;
}
.marcas img {
float: left;
border: 1px solid #CCCCCC;
}
.marcas {
float:left;
width:auto;
margin: 0px 9px 9px 0px;
}
.marcas p {
font-weight:bold;
}
	
/* SECCION MARCAS HOMBRE Y MUJER */



/* SECCION TRABAJA AQUI */
.contenido_trabaja {
width: 721px;
padding: 30px 20px 100px 20px;
}
.trabaja_texto {
line-height:18px;
text-align:justify;
width: 350px;
float: left;
margin-top:15px;
}
.titulo_trabaja {
background-color:#53a100;
margin:10px 20px 0px 20px;
}
.titulo_trabaja h1 {
padding: 5px 10px 5px 10px;
color:#FFFFFF;
font-size:12px;
font-weight:bold;
}
.trabaja-aqui h2 {
letter-spacing: 0px;
color:#53a100;
text-transform:none;
font-size: 20px;
font-weight:100;
}
.trabaja_texto a:link {
font-weight: bold;
color:#FFFFFF;
text-decoration: none;
text-transform: none;
}
.trabaja_texto a:visited {
font-weight: bold;
color:#FFFFFF;
text-decoration: none;
text-transform: none;
}
.trabaja_texto a:hover {
background: transparent;
text-decoration:line-through;
text-transform: none;
}
.linkeo_verde { /* LINKEO DE COOR VERDE */
text-transform:none;
background:#53a100; padding:1px 3px 1px 3px;
font-size: 12px;
margin-top: 3px;
}
/* SECCION TRABAJA AQUI */




/* SECCION LOCALES */
.contenido_locales { 
width: 721px;
padding: 20px 20px 20px 20px;
}
.titulo_locales {
background-color:#666666;
margin: 10px 20px 0px 20px;
}
.titulo_locales h1 {
padding: 5px 10px 5px 10px;
color:#FFFFFF;
font-size:12px;
font-weight:bold;
}
.local h2 {
letter-spacing: 0px;
color:#666666;
font-size: 16px;
}
.local {
width: 343px;
height:80px;
float: left;
padding: 3px 3px 6px 3px;
margin-bottom: 15px;
}
/* SECCION LOCALES */




/* SECCION KIDS */
.titulo_kids {
background-color:#fe8d07;
margin:10px 20px 0px 20px;
}
.titulo_kids h1 {
padding: 5px 10px 5px 10px;
color:#FFFFFF;
font-size:12px;
font-weight:bold;
}
/* SECCION KIDS */



/* SECCION PACKS */
.titulo_packs {
background-color:#53a100;
margin:10px 20px 0px 20px;
}
.titulo_packs h1 {
padding: 5px 10px 5px 10px;
color:#FFFFFF;
font-size:12px;
font-weight:bold;
}
/* SECCION PACKS */




/* SECCION HOMBRE */
.contenido_catalogo { 
width: 741px;
padding: 20px 0px 20px 0px;
}
.titulo_hombre {
background-color:#3DAEF2;
margin:10px 20px 0px 20px;
}
.titulo_hombre h1 {
padding: 5px 10px 5px 10px;
color:#FFFFFF;
font-size:12px;
font-weight:bold;
}
.img_hombre_izq h2 {
color:#666666;
font-size:12px;
font-weight:bold;
text-decoration:underline;
margin-bottom:3px;
margin-left:3px;
}
.img_hombre_izq p {
margin-left:2px;
}
.img_hombre_izq {
width: 344px;
float: left;
padding: 2px;
margin-bottom:20px;
margin-left:20px;
}
* html .img_hombre_izq {  /*para IE*/
margin-left:11px;
}
.img_hombre_izq img {
padding: 2px 2px 2px 2px;
border: 1px solid #CCCCCC;
margin-bottom:3px;
}
/* SECCION HOMBRE */




/*SECCION MUJER CATALOGO*/
.img_mujer_izq h2 {
color:#666666;
font-size:12px;
font-weight:bold;
text-decoration:underline;
margin-bottom:3px;
margin-left:3px;
}
.img_mujer_izq p {
margin-left:2px;
}
.img_mujer_izq {
width: 344px;
float: left;
padding: 2px;
margin-bottom:20px;
margin-left:20px;
}
* html .img_mujer_izq {  /*para IE*/
margin-left:11px;
}
.img_mujer_izq img {
padding: 2px 2px 2px 2px;
border: 1px solid #CCCCCC;
margin-bottom:3px;
}
/*SECCION MUJER CATALOGO*/





/* SECCION MUJER */
.titulo_mujer {
background-color:#99258c;
margin:10px 20px 0px 20px;
}
.titulo_mujer h1 {
padding: 5px 10px 5px 10px;
color:#FFFFFF;
font-size:12px;
font-weight:bold;
}
/* SECCION MUJER */








/* NOVEDADES */
.contenido_novedades { 
width: 721px;
padding: 20px 20px 20px 20px;
}
.titulo_novedades {
background-color:#53a100;
margin: 10px 20px 0px 20px;
}
.titulo_novedades p {
padding: 5px 10px 5px 10px;
color:#53f206;
}
.titulo_novedades h1 {
padding: 5px 10px 5px 10px;
color:#ffffff;
font-size:12px;
}
.posteo {
margin: 0px 0px 30px 0px;
overflow:hidden;
}
.posteo h2 {
letter-spacing: 0px;
color:#666666;
text-transform: uppercase;
font-size: 16px;
}
.posteo h3 {
color:#53a100;
font-size:14px;
margin: 0px 0px 8px 0px;
}
.posteo h4 {
color:#666666;
font-size: 14px;
margin: 0px 0px 8px 0px;
text-transform: uppercase;
}
.imgposteo { 
width: 486px;
float: left;
}
.imgposteo img {
padding: 2px;
border: 1px solid #CCCCCC;
}
.contenidopost {
width: 214px;
float: right;
text-align: justify;
}
.aliniarderecha { 
text-transform: uppercase;
float:right;
background:#53a100; 
width:62px; 
padding:2px 3px;
font-size: 10px;
margin-top: 6px;
}
.contenidopost a:link {
font-weight: bold;
color:#FFFFFF;
text-decoration: none;
text-transform: none;
}
.contenidopost a:visited {
font-weight: bold;
color:#FFFFFF;
text-decoration: none;
text-transform: none;
}
.contenidopost a:hover {
background: transparent;
text-decoration:line-through;
text-transform: none;
}
/* NOVEDADES */



/* NOVEDADES INTERNA */
.imgposteo_in {
width: 486px;
float: left;
}
.imgposteo_in img {
padding: 2px;
border: 1px solid #CCCCCC;
}
.contenidopost_in {
width: 492px;
float: left;
margin:10px 0px 20px 0px;
text-align: justify;
}
.contenido_in { 
width: 492px;
margin: 20px auto 0px auto;
}
.contenido_in a:link {
color:#FFFFFF;
text-decoration: none;
text-transform: none;
}
.contenido_in a:visited {
color:#FFFFFF;
text-decoration: none;
text-transform: none;
}
.contenido_in a:hover {
background: transparent;
text-decoration:line-through;
}
.aliniarderecha_in {
text-transform: uppercase;
float:right;
background:#53a100; width:42px; padding:2px 3px;
font-size: 10px;
margin-top: 6px;
}
.linkeo { /* P CLASS ALINEAR DERECHA */
text-transform:none;
background:#babbbb; width:42px; padding:0px 2px 0px 2px;
font-size: 12px;
margin-top: 3px;
}
/* NOVEDADES INTERNA */




/* FOOTER */
.footer {
background-image:url(img/footer.png);
width:761px;
height:88px;
text-align:center;
}
.footer p {
color:#53f206;
font-size:10px;
padding-left:12px;
padding-top:65px;
}
/* FOOTER */



/* HOLIDAY 2009 */
.linea_catalogo {
background-color:#cccccc;
height:1px;
overflow:hidden;
margin: 40px 10px 10px 1px;
float:left;
width:720px;
}
.logo_catalogo {
margin: 15px 0px 25px 0px;
float:left;
width:720px;
}
.tilla_catalogo h2 { 
color:#999999;
font-size:12px;
font-weight:bold;
}
.tilla_catalogo {
width: 232px;
height:auto;
float: left;
padding: 3px 3px 6px 3px;
margin-bottom:20px;
}
.tilla_catalogo img {
margin: 0px 9px 7px 0px;
border: 1px solid #CCCCCC;
}
.disponible_h {
color:#3DAEF2;
text-decoration:underline;
}
.disponible_m {
color:#87257c;
text-decoration:underline;
}
 /* HOLIDAY 2009 */
 
 
 
 
 .tilla_pack {
width: 232px;
height:auto;
float: left;
padding: 3px 3px 0px 3px;
}
.tilla_pack img {
margin: 0px 9px 0px 0px;
border: 1px solid #CCCCCC;
}
 
 
 
 
 
.seccion {
color:#000000;
}
.verde { 
color:#53a100;
font-size: 12px;
text-decoration:underline;
}

 
 
 .contenido_sinmarca {
width: 729px;
height:400px;
padding: 20px 12px 30px 20px;
}
.contenido_sinmarca p{
color:#666666;
}
.titulo_zona {
margin: 25px 20px 0px 20px;
}
.linea_zona {
background-color:#cccccc;
height:1px;
overflow:hidden;
margin: 0px 20px 0px 20px;
}
.titulo_zona h3 {
font-size:10px;
color:#999999;
font-weight:normal;
}
.entradas_anteriores { 
text-transform: uppercase;
float:left;
background:#e6e5e5; 
width:auto; 
padding:2px 3px;
font-size: 10px;
margin-top: 6px;
}
.entradas_siguientes { 
text-transform: uppercase;
float:RIGHT;
background:#e6e5e5; 
width:auto; 
padding:2px 3px;
font-size: 10px;
margin-top: 6px;
}




* html .clearfix {
height: 1%;
}
.transitions {
float: left;
}
.clearfix:after {
content: ".";
display: block;
height: 0;
clear: both;
visibility: hidden;
}
.clearfix {
display: inline-block;
text-align: left;
}
.clearfix {
display: block;
}
<!-[if IE 7]>
.clearfix {
display:inline-block;
}
.clearfix {
display:block;
}
<![endif]->